Australian soup market to reach $588 million mark by 2024
The Australian soups sector is projected to grow from $509.9 million in 2019 to A$588 m in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.9 per cent, according to data analytics company GlobalData.

APAC consumers drinking less alcohol
Teetotalism trends in the Asia-Pacific region are becoming increasingly prevalent, with approximately three out of four (71 per cent) of consumers drinking less alcohol in August 2020, according to a survey by leading data and analytics company GlobalData. However, the adoption of alternative soft drinks remains low, at only one in five consumers.

Cheer is new name for Coon cheese
Saputo Dairy Australia, the operating subsidiary of Saputo. in Australia, is hereby issuing this media release to announce Cheer Cheese is the new name for Coon cheese in Australia. The name change follows Saputo’s careful and diligent review to honour the brand-affinity felt by our consumers while aligning with current attitudes and perspectives.
Pizza Hut takes leaf out of Coles’ book
Pizza Hut Australia has made a strategic move as it continues to take a larger slice of the food-on-the-go consumer spend. The business has begun trialling service station kiosks to bring further accessibility to the brand. Driven by Allegro Funds, Pizza Hut has partnered with Euro Garages Australia and has opened its second kiosk in a Liverpool based service station in New South Wales, with a third planned to open in early 2021.
Gingin produces gin
His small tin shed distillery only opened in 2016, but James Young has already won back-to-back Distillery of the Year titles at Australia’s most prestigious spirit competition. With that enviable title under his belt, the Perth local is about to see his lifelong dream become a reality; the opening of brand-new distillery in Gingin, and the launch of a world class gin of the same calibre that earnt Old Young’s the highest accolade possible at the Australian Distilled Spirit Awards in 2017 and 2018.
